10 Key Questions to Ask Your eCommerce Fulfilment Provider

Choosing the right eCommerce fulfilment provider is a pivotal decision for any online business. The fulfilment partner you select is more than just a logistical service, they act as an extension of your brand. Their performance will directly affect customer satisfaction, retention rates and your ability to scale. With so much at stake, it’s critical to evaluate potential providers thoroughly.

This in-depth guide covers the 10 most important questions you should ask when assessing eCommerce fulfilment providers. We will look at what these questions show and why they are important. We will also discuss the “green flags” that indicate a reliable and high-quality partner for outsourced eCommerce operations.

1. What Is Your Experience in eCommerce Fulfilment?

Experience is a key indicator of a provider’s ability to handle the complexities of your business. While every fulfilment provider will promise great service, it’s their track record that truly speaks volumes.

Why Ask This? An experienced partner will have faced a range of challenges and developed strategies to overcome them. They’ll also be familiar with industry trends, compliance requirements, and customer expectations.

Follow-Up Questions:

  • How long have you been in the eCommerce fulfilment industry?
  • Have you worked with businesses of a similar size and scale to mine?
  • Do you specialise in any particular industries or product categories?

Green Flag:  A fulfilment provider with over ten years of experience can offer valuable knowledge. If they have worked with businesses like yours, they can provide useful insights. Their experience should extend to managing inventory, navigating peak seasons and handling unexpected challenges like supply chain disruptions. For UK eCommerce fulfilment, it’s essential they understand the local market nuances.

2. What Technology Do You Use?

Modern eCommerce relies heavily on technology, and your fulfilment provider should be no exception. Advanced systems for inventory management, order tracking, and analytics are crucial to streamlining operations.

Why Ask This? Technology impacts everything from the speed of order processing to the accuracy of inventory updates. Seamless integration with your eCommerce platform ensures real-time data syncs, which helps you provide a smooth shopping experience.

Follow-Up Questions:

  • Can your system integrate with platforms like Shopify, Magento, or WooCommerce?
  • Do you offer tools for inventory forecasting or analytics?
  • How do you ensure the security of sensitive customer and business data?

Green Flag: A fulfilment partner with cutting-edge technology, such as automated warehouse systems and robust API integrations, can offer efficiency and transparency. Their systems should also be user-friendly, allowing you to track performance metrics and inventory in real time. Shopify order fulfilment, in particular, benefits from seamless integrations.

3. How Do You Ensure Order Accuracy?

Order accuracy is non-negotiable in eCommerce. Mistakes such as sending the wrong item or incorrect quantities can damage your reputation and lead to costly returns.

Why Ask This? Accurate order fulfilment ensures customer satisfaction and reduces the likelihood of negative reviews or lost revenue. Providers must have robust quality control measures in place.

Follow-Up Questions:

  • What is your current order accuracy rate?
  • How do you prevent errors during the picking, packing, and shipping processes?
  • What steps do you take to resolve issues when they occur?

Green Flag: A provider with an order accuracy rate of 99% or higher demonstrates a commitment to excellence. Look for clear procedures like double-checking processes and a culture of accountability. This is particularly important for outsourced eCommerce fulfilment where every mistake reflects on your brand.

4. What Are Your Shipping Capabilities?

Shipping speed and reliability are critical in today’s eCommerce landscape, where customers expect fast and affordable delivery options.

Why Ask This? The shipping capabilities of your fulfilment provider will directly affect your ability to meet customer expectations. A provider with a wide network and strong partnerships can offer better delivery options.

Follow-Up Questions:

  • Which carriers do you partner with?
  • Do you offer same-day or next-day shipping?

Green Flag: A provider with flexible shipping options, strong relationships with reliable couriers, and competitive rates can ensure your customers receive their orders on time.

5. How Do You Handle Returns?

Returns are an inevitable part of eCommerce. A smooth and efficient returns process can enhance customer loyalty and simplify inventory management.

Why Ask This? Your fulfilment provider’s returns process will reflect on your brand. Customers expect returns to be hassle-free, and delays or confusion can erode trust.

Follow-Up Questions:

  • What is your average processing time for returns?
  • Do you offer reverse logistics solutions?
  • How do you handle damaged or defective items?

Green Flag: Providers with a streamlined returns process, including fast processing times and clear communication with customers, are ideal. Look for features like pre-printed return labels and real-time tracking of returned items. A fulfilment provider that can efficiently handle returns reduces the operational burden on your business.

6. How Do You Support Business Growth?

As your business grows, your fulfilment provider needs to grow with you. Scalability is a critical factor in long-term success.

Why Ask This? A fulfilment provider that meets your current needs but cannot grow will slow you down when you expand.

Follow-Up Questions:

  • How do you handle seasonal spikes in demand?
  • What is your capacity for scaling storage and fulfilment services?

Green Flag: A strong history of helping fast-growing businesses shows that a provider can support your long-term goals. Flexible contracts and adaptable systems are also positive signs. Outsourced eCommerce providers with the ability to scale their inventory management service are invaluable for seasonal peaks.

7. What Is Your Pricing Structure?

Cost is an important factor, but transparency is equally crucial. Unexpected fees or confusing pricing models can lead to frustration.

Why Ask This? Understanding your fulfilment provider’s pricing structure ensures you can budget accurately and avoid unpleasant surprises.

Follow-Up Questions:

  • Are there any hidden fees for storage, handling, or additional services?
  • Can you provide a detailed breakdown of costs?

Green Flag: A transparent and predictable pricing structure, with no hidden fees, demonstrates a trustworthy partner. Outsourcing order fulfilment should deliver value while keeping costs manageable.

8. How Do You Ensure Data Security?

In an era of data breaches, protecting customer and business information is more important than ever.

Why Ask This? Your fulfilment provider will have access to sensitive data, including customer addresses and payment details. Robust data security measures are essential.

Follow-Up Questions:

  • Are you compliant with data protection regulations like GDPR?
  • What cybersecurity measures do you have in place?
  • How do you handle data breaches if they occur?

Green Flag: Providers with certifications like ISO27001 and end-to-end encryption show they care about your data security. They take a proactive approach to cybersecurity. This is vital for any online order fulfilment company.

9. What Is Your Customer Support Like?

Problems can arise at any time, and responsive customer support can make all the difference.

Why Ask This? Good communication ensures smooth operations and allows you to resolve issues quickly, minimising disruptions.

Follow-Up Questions:

  • Do you provide a dedicated Account Manager?
  • Do you have a Customer Services team?
  • What are your support hours?
  • How quickly do you respond to queries?

Green Flag: A fulfilment partner with a helpful support team and dedicated Account Managers can guide you through challenges. They focus on customer care to make things easier for you. This is essential for outsourced fulfilment partnerships. An added bonus is the provider having a Customer Services function who can handle all customer queries.

10. Can You Provide References or Case Studies?

A fulfilment provider’s past performance is one of the best indicators of future success. Case studies and references provide valuable insight into their capabilities.

Why Ask This? Hearing directly from other businesses can validate a provider’s claims and highlight their strengths.

Follow-Up Questions:

  • Can you share testimonials from clients in my industry?
  • Do you have case studies that show measurable results?
  • Are there any long-term clients I can speak with?

Green Flag: Providers who willingly share references and case studies demonstrate confidence in their services. Look for examples of businesses like yours that achieved growth and improved efficiency. A strong track record is essential for any order fulfilment company aiming to establish trust.

Final Thoughts

Choosing the right eCommerce fulfilment provider is a decision that will impact every aspect of your business. By asking these ten questions, you can make sure your partner shares your goals. They should also offer the expertise, technology, and scalability you need to succeed.
